Amman, Feb. 18 (Petra) - Jordan is taking part in the Third Arab International Land Conference hosted by Morocco, under the theme:"Land solutions for investments, resilience, and innovation". The event, which kicked off Tuesday, and will continue until February 20, is held in partnership with the UN-Habitat, Arab Land Initiative and other relevant bodies. Speaking at the conference, Jordan's representative, Director General of the Department of Lands and Survey (DLS), Dr. Ahmad Omoush, said the participation aims to exchange knowledge, enhance joint cooperation and coordination and learn about the "best" global practices and standards in land management (LM) domains. Omoush added that Jordan also seeks to benefit from "advanced" countries' expertise in LM fields and enhance and stimulate the investment environment in the Jordanian real estate sector. The conference, he noted, represents an "important" milestone in promoting "sound" land governance to achieve social, economic, environmental and peace gains in the Arab region. On agenda, he stated the discussions provide a platform to tackle countries' experiences, present new research, guide investments, and enhance "high-level" commitment to improving the land sector. //Petra// AG
